11
A
回答
9
sudo apt-get install build-essential gobjc gobjc++ gnustep gnustep-devel libgnustep-base-dev -y
vi *.m
gcc `gnustep-config --objc-flags` *.m -lgnustep-base -lobjc
9
您下載並構建LLVM作爲編譯器基礎結構;然後下載並構建CLANG前端以編譯C/C++和Objective C/C++。
我想你可以試試以下quick start指南。在使用這些語言時,請注意Clang實際上可以取代GCC。
+0
快速入門僅適用於編譯C程序... – Rusfearuth 2012-07-11 16:51:08
3
看看http://www.gnustep.org/他們有用於開發針對LINUX的Objective-C 2.0的工具。源文件和提示如何在多種Linux發行版安裝在這裏:http://www.gnustep.org/resources/sources.html
0
只要運行這個頁面上顯示以下文字:
https://gist.github.com/nicerobot/5652802
關注:在第一次編譯過程你會得到一個錯誤。解決方案只是重新編譯它...它的工作原理!這裏是從一步一步安裝的博客條目,但我真的推薦腳本!
問候
相關問題
- 1. LINQPad如何編譯代碼?
- 2. 如何編譯FastCGI ++代碼?
- 3. 如何編譯java代碼?
- 4. 如何編譯cython代碼
- 5. 如何編譯CIL代碼?
- 6. 如何編譯Fortran代碼?
- 7. erlang-如何編譯和代碼
- 8. 如何編譯64位彙編代碼
- 9. 如何編譯彙編代碼?
- 10. 如何編譯在Visual C C++編寫代碼表示2010
- 11. 如何編寫和編譯Apache Handler?
- 12. 如何編寫和編譯「對飛」
- 13. 如何編寫JavaScript代碼
- 14. 如何編寫僞代碼
- 15. 如何編寫html5代碼
- 16. 如何編寫HTML代碼
- 17. 如何編寫此代碼?
- 18. 如何編寫PHP代碼
- 19. 如何編寫sass代碼?
- 20. 如何直接編譯代碼中最初編寫的代碼:: blocks
- 21. 代碼合同和編譯
- 22. Java代碼和JIT編譯
- 23. 運行期間:編寫,編譯和使用C#代碼?
- 24. 在運行時編寫和編譯源代碼?
- 25. JS編譯器同時編寫前端和後端代碼
- 26. GMP-彙編代碼?編譯代碼
- 27. 你如何使用Mac OS 10上的終端編寫和編譯C++代碼?
- 28. 如何編寫將編譯,加載和使用網絡代碼的Java程序
- 29. 反編譯彙編代碼
- 30. 如何編譯高級代碼以獲取彙編代碼?
([對Objective-C和Linux下的遊戲編程]的可能的複製http://stackoverflow.com/questions/447942/game-programming-on-objective- c-and-linux) – Kay 2012-07-11 16:44:46
@Kay我不會將其作爲重複關閉,因爲其他問題只有preng/llvm答案。 – dasblinkenlight 2012-07-11 17:01:58
[在Linux中啓動iPhone應用程序開發?](http://stackoverflow.com/questions/276907/starting-iphone-app-development-in-linux) – 2012-07-11 17:19:56